Apple ABA is seeking an experienced Registered Behavior Technician (RBT) to join our team. We are a dedicated ABA company committed to transforming lives through evidence-based practices. Our culture promotes collaboration, growth, and client success. RBTs in our supportive environment benefit from professional development opportunities and making a positive impact in children’s lives.

Benefits:
  • $250 Sign-on Bonus
  • Bonus Opportunities
  • Competitive Pay Rates ($25.00/hr - $30.00/hr)
  • Flexible Schedules
  • Employee Referral Bonuses
  • Career Advancement Opportunities
Responsibilities:
  • Provide 1:1 ABA therapy to clients in-home, in-school, or in-clinic.
  • Implement treatment plans designed by a BCBA.
  • Collect and document client progress data.
  • Collaborate with families and team members.
  • Maintain a safe and positive environment during sessions.
Schedule and Location:
  • Flexible shifts based on availability.
  • Location: New Jersey.
Qualifications:
  • Must have or be willing to obtain RBT certification.
  • High School Diploma or equivalent; some college preferred.
  • Experience in ABA therapy or with children is a plus but not required.
  • Ability to pass background check.
  • Reliable transportation and willingness to travel locally.
